update 利元亨内网登录页修改

This commit is contained in:
2026-04-16 20:38:26 +08:00
parent 7f5b098c50
commit 0dbe1ff609
2 changed files with 34 additions and 4 deletions

View File

@@ -26,7 +26,9 @@ export default {
readAccept: '我已仔细阅读并接受',
privacyPolicy: '《隐私政策》',
phoneAndJobCodeLabel: '手机号/工号',
phoneAndJobCodePlaceholder: '请输入手机号/工号'
phoneAndJobCodePlaceholder: '请输入手机号/工号',
jobCodeLabel: '工号',
jobCodePlaceholder: '请输入工号',
},
mobile: {
label1: '手机号',

View File

@@ -9,10 +9,37 @@
hide-required-asterisk
@keyup.enter="handleVerify"
>
<el-form-item class="login-animation1" prop="username" :label="$t('password.phoneAndJobCodeLabel')">
<el-input text :placeholder="$t('password.phoneAndJobCodePlaceholder')" v-model="state.ruleForm.username" clearable autocomplete="off">
<el-form-item
class="login-animation1"
prop="username"
:label="['lyric-intranet'].includes(CODE_ENV) ? $t('password.jobCodeLabel') : $t('password.phoneAndJobCodeLabel')"
>
<el-input
text
:placeholder="['lyric-intranet'].includes(CODE_ENV) ? $t('password.jobCodePlaceholder') : $t('password.phoneAndJobCodePlaceholder')"
v-model="state.ruleForm.username"
clearable
autocomplete="off"
>
<template #prefix>
<el-icon class="el-input__icon">
<svg
v-if="['lyric-intranet'].includes(CODE_ENV)"
t="1776342254777"
class="icon"
viewBox="0 0 1024 1024"
version="1.1"
xmlns="http://www.w3.org/2000/svg"
p-id="3274"
width="14"
height="14"
>
<path
d="M955.733333 955.733333H68.266667a68.266667 68.266667 0 0 1-68.266667-68.266666V204.8a68.266667 68.266667 0 0 1 68.266667-68.266667h136.533333a34.133333 34.133333 0 0 1 0 68.266667H102.4a34.133333 34.133333 0 0 0-34.133333 34.133333v614.4a34.133333 34.133333 0 0 0 34.133333 34.133334h819.2a34.133333 34.133333 0 0 0 34.133333-34.133334V238.933333a34.133333 34.133333 0 0 0-34.133333-34.133333h-102.4a34.133333 34.133333 0 0 1 0-68.266667h136.533333a68.266667 68.266667 0 0 1 68.266667 68.266667v682.666667a68.266667 68.266667 0 0 1-68.266667 68.266666zM733.866667 273.066667h-34.133334a17.066667 17.066667 0 0 1-17.066666-17.066667v-170.666667a17.066667 17.066667 0 0 1 17.066666-17.066666h34.133334a17.066667 17.066667 0 0 1 17.066666 17.066666v170.666667a17.066667 17.066667 0 0 1-17.066666 17.066667z m102.4 273.066666a17.066667 17.066667 0 0 1 17.066666 17.066667v34.133333a17.066667 17.066667 0 0 1-17.066666 17.066667h-136.533334a17.066667 17.066667 0 0 1-17.066666-17.066667v-34.133333a17.066667 17.066667 0 0 1 17.066666-17.066667h136.533334zM614.4 392.533333v-34.133333a17.066667 17.066667 0 0 1 17.066667-17.066667h204.8a17.066667 17.066667 0 0 1 17.066666 17.066667v34.133333a17.066667 17.066667 0 0 1-17.066666 17.066667h-204.8a17.066667 17.066667 0 0 1-17.066667-17.066667zM614.4 204.8h-204.8a34.133333 34.133333 0 0 1 0-68.266667h204.8a34.133333 34.133333 0 0 1 0 68.266667zM324.266667 273.066667h-34.133334a17.066667 17.066667 0 0 1-17.066666-17.066667v-170.666667a17.066667 17.066667 0 0 1 17.066666-17.066666h34.133334a17.066667 17.066667 0 0 1 17.066666 17.066666v170.666667a17.066667 17.066667 0 0 1-17.066666 17.066667zM375.466667 307.2a136.533333 136.533333 0 0 1 136.533333 136.533333c0 30.0032-9.966933 57.5488-26.385067 80.0768A153.6 153.6 0 0 1 580.266667 665.6V785.066667H170.666667v-119.466667a153.6 153.6 0 0 1 94.651733-141.789867A135.441067 135.441067 0 0 1 238.933333 443.733333a136.533333 136.533333 0 0 1 136.533334-136.533333z m0 68.266667a68.266667 68.266667 0 1 0 0 136.533333 68.266667 68.266667 0 0 0 0-136.533333z m-136.533334 290.133333V716.8h273.066667v-51.2a85.333333 85.333333 0 0 0-85.333333-85.333333h-102.4A85.333333 85.333333 0 0 0 238.933333 665.6z"
fill="#A8ABB2"
p-id="3275"
></path>
</svg>
<el-icon v-else class="el-input__icon">
<ele-User />
</el-icon>
</template>
@@ -111,6 +138,7 @@ import { uploadFormat } from '/@/utils/commonFunction';
import { Session } from '/@/utils/storage';
import { useLocalStorage } from '@vueuse/core';
import { enableConfigByTenant } from '/@/spdm/utils/index'; // SPDM CODE
import { CODE_ENV } from '/@/spdm/config';
const props = defineProps({
showBrowserMsgText: {